Product Information

Indole-3-Glyoxylamide is a versatile compound recognized for its significant role in various biochemical applications. This compound, also known as 3-Indolylglyoxylic acid amide, is particularly valued in the field of medicinal chemistry for its potential as a building block in the synthesis of bioactive molecules. Its unique structure allows for interactions with biological systems, making it a candidate for research in drug development, particularly in targeting cancer and neurodegenerative diseases.

Researchers have utilized Indole-3-Glyoxylamide in studies exploring its effects on cellular signaling pathways, showcasing its potential in modulating biological responses. Its ability to act as a precursor in the synthesis of indole derivatives further enhances its relevance in organic synthesis and pharmaceutical formulations. CAS Number
5548-10-7
Molecular Formula
C10H8N2O2
Molecular Weight
188.19
MDL Number
MFCD00047174
PubChem ID
73227
Conditions
Store at 0-8°C

Applications

Indole-3-Glyoxylamide is widely utilized in research focused on

  • Pharmaceutical Development: This compound is explored for its potential in drug formulation, particularly in developing treatments for various cancers due to its ability to modulate biological pathways.
  • Plant Growth Regulation: It is used in agricultural research to enhance plant growth and resistance, making it valuable for developing eco-friendly fertilizers and growth stimulants.
  • Biochemical Research: Researchers employ it in studies related to enzyme inhibition and protein interactions, aiding in the understanding of metabolic processes and disease mechanisms.
  • Material Science: Indole-3-Glyoxylamide finds applications in creating novel materials, particularly in the development of organic semiconductors and sensors due to its unique electronic properties.
  • Cosmetic Formulations: The compound is being investigated for its potential benefits in skincare products, particularly for its antioxidant properties that can help in anti-aging formulations.
